Devilishly Definitions
1 of 2) Devilishly, Diabolically, Fiendishly : شیطانی طریقے سے : (adverb) as a devil; in an evil manner.
2 of 2) Devilishly, Deadly, Deucedly, Insanely, Madly : نہایت, بے حد : (adverb) (used as intensives) extremely.
